Retuning to the previously viewed web page is a common yet uneasy task to the large volume of personally accessed information on the web. This paper leverages humans natural recall process of using episodic and semantic memory cues to facilitate recall and personal web revisitation technique called web page prev through context and content keywords. The episodic memory means that it used for incidental memory and also used for a context (graphical) semantic memory used for a webpage in (day to day) that include content keyword. Relevance feedback mechanism is also involved to tailor individual's memory strength and revisitation habits.
